Scandinavian tapestry weaving - Philosophical Concept | Alexandria

Scandinavian tapestry weaving: An ancient art form, seemingly straightforward in its construction, yet concealing layers of cultural narrative and symbolic w...

Scandinavian tapestry weaving - Philosophical Concept | Alexandria

View in Alexandria